Ricardo Gonzalez discusses how he utilized Caspio’s low-code platform to enhance processes at UC Berkeley's School of Education.
In this episode of Low Code/High Impact, we sit down with Ricardo Gonzalez, Applications Programmer at the University of California (UC), Berkeley. Ricardo shares how he has used Caspio’s low-code platform for over two years to replace time-consuming manual processes within the UC Berkeley School of Education. His work includes building internal education apps that automate student certificate generation and developing a secure, cloud-based database application that supports regional academie...
